Output 3e652e2c6dd93d3a09e039d98506bf178e2b15510dbd981be70a6aa46b63698c:0

value
754167
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e026a8e464f10f83876d5da75a1bb4a829737c9b OP_EQUAL
address
3N8Dbe2gcF8qrmvhxcZ4N5tYSkVVucGq4t
transaction
3e652e2c6dd93d3a09e039d98506bf178e2b15510dbd981be70a6aa46b63698c
confirmations
211442
spent
true